Step 1: Assessment and Planning
Our team will assess the damage and develop a customized plan to tackle the job. We’ll identify the affected areas and find out the best course of action to restore your floors.
Step 2: Water Extraction
We’ll use specialized equipment to extract as much water as possible from the affected area. This is a critical step in preventing further damage and ensuring a successful restoration.
Step 3: Drying and Dehumidification
We’ll use industrial-strength fans and dehumidifiers to dry the area quickly and efficiently. This helps prevent mold growth and further damage.
Step 4: Repair and Replacement
Our technicians will repair or replace damaged flooring as needed. We use only the highest-quality materials to ensure a seamless finish.
Step 5: Final Inspection and Touch-ups
We’ll conduct a thorough inspection to ensure that the job is complete and meets our high standards. Any necessary touch-ups will be made to ensure a flawless finish.

Floor Water Damage Restoration vs. DIY: When To Call a Professional
| Situation | DIY? | Call a Pro? | Why |
|---|---|---|---|
| Small water spill (less than 1 square foot) | Yes | No | DIY methods are enough for small spills. |
| Standing water (over 1 inch deep) | No | Yes | Standing water needs professional equipment and expertise to extract and dry. |
| Warped or buckled flooring | No | Yes | Warped or buckled flooring needs professional repair or replacement. |
| Musty odors or mold growth | No | Yes | Mold growth needs professional remediation to ensure safety and prevent further damage. |
| Large water damage (over 10 square feet) | No | Yes | Large water damage needs professional equipment and expertise to extract, dry, and repair. |
| Hidden water damage (behind walls or under flooring) | No | Yes | Hidden water damage needs professional inspection and repair to ensure safety and prevent further damage. |

Floor Water Damage Restoration Cost in Providence, UT
The cost of Floor Water Damage Restoration in Providence, UT, can vary depending on the severity of the damage, the size of the affected area, and local conditions. Our prices are estimates, not guarantees, and will depend on an on-site assessment. But, here are some typical price ranges for different aspects of the service:
| Service | Typical Price Range | What Affects Cost |
|---|---|---|
| Water Extraction | $500 – $2,500 | Size of affected area, type of flooring, and equipment required |
| Drying and Dehumidification | $1,000 – $5,000 | Size of affected area, type of equipment required, and duration of the process |
| Repair and Replacement | $2,000 – $10,000 | Type of flooring, extent of damage, and materials required |
| Final Inspection and Touch-ups | $500 – $2,000 | Size of affected area and complexity of the job |
